Descripción

*** Pendiente de traducción *** xrdp is an open source RDP server. Versions 0.10.6 and prior contain a heap-based buffer overflow vulnerability within the virtual channel forwarding mechanism. When forwarding data from a remote client to the internal channel server, the xrdp process utilizes a fixed-size buffer without adequate bounds checking on the incoming payload. An authenticated remote attacker can exploit this flaw by sending a specially crafted virtual channel message that exceeds the buffer capacity, leading to heap memory corruption. This may result in a denial of service or the execution of arbitrary code with the privileges of the xrdp process. This issue has been fixed in version 0.10.6.1.
